Nursery Worker

Alpha Consolidated Contracting Services, LLC is looking to fill 31 Nursery Worker positions. Worksite(s): Provided daily transportation to and from the worksite; @ $16.02/hr. Begin in Inver Grove Heights, Dakota County, MN; continue into worksite in Dakota County, MN or Anoka County, MN; Minneapolis-St. Paul-Bloomington MN-WI area. This is a temporary, full-time seasonal position from 11/13/2022 to 12/10/2022.

 

Duties: Duties may include: product assembly wreath maker worker requires gather, sheer, cut manual, treat, arrange, tie, package of previously gathered raw nursery-Christmas tree, limbs, boughs, etc. material. Cut natural pine product @ 11” w/clippers, tie, treat, arrange to produce wreaths. Another worker tie up bouquet w/ a circular hook. 100% quality must be done & other related Nursery Worker activities as per SOC/OES 45-2092 (onetonline.org). 

 

Requirements: Must show proof of legal authority to work in the U.S. Drug/Alcohol/Tobacco free work zone. Perform physical activities such as: lift, balance, walk, stoop, handle, position, move, manipulate materials use static strength to exert max muscle force to lift, push, pull, carry objects up to 60lbs (possible 2-person). Must have 3 months Wreath Assembly exp. No minimum education requirement.  All applicants must be able, willing, qualified to perform work described and must be available for the entire period specified and work throughout all areas of intended employment. Based on Employer's discretion/cost: Worker may have random drug/alcohol testing during employment: positive test/ refusal to abide   = dismissal. Possible background check post hire at employer's expense. Work is indoor/outdoor: Temperature changes due to climate control for product storage/gathering is outdoors. Due to wet climate conditions; may walk in mud and must be able to work in potentially wet clothes. Rashes, allergies may occur due to exposure to pine dust, contaminants, bugs; finger cuts may occur as working with limbs, etc.  Extensive standing, stooping, bending (no sitting; no cell phone use or smoking or drinking during work hours). Quality guidelines apply. Must have hand dexterity. Must work full Christmas seasonal contract. Daily production target must be met by workers. Must keep housing clean and tidy.

 

 

Terms & Conditions of Employment: $16.02/hr OT $24.03/hr. Depends on Experience. The wage(s) offered equal(s) or exceed(s) the highest of the prevailing wage or the Federal, State, or local minimum wage. At Employer’s sole discretion: possible raises and/or bonuses based on individual factors such as work performance or skill (not guaranteed); possible cash advances (if applicable/requested by worker, potential deduction from worker’s paycheck).Piece Rate may apply: worker will never make less than Prevailing Wage/Federal/state/local minimum wage. Bonuses may apply at employers discretion.

 

 

Possible daily/weekly hours: 7:00AM-6:00PM. 35-60++ (plus) to include lunch break, M-F. Possible weekend/holiday work. (Overtime possible, but not required or guaranteed. If overtime is worked, wage is paid at a rate of time and a half per hour worked beyond 40 hours each week.)  Overtime not required. This employer will also comply with all applicable federal, state and local laws pertaining to overtime hours.  

 

Transportation: Transportation and subsistence will be reimbursed (by check in 1st work week) for cost from the place from which the worker has come to work for the employer, whether in the U.S. or abroad, to the place of employment.

 

Upon completion of the work contract or where the worker is dismissed earlier, employer will provide or pay for worker’s reasonable costs of return transportation and subsistence back home or to the place the worker originally departed to work, except where the worker will not return due to subsequent employment with another employer. The amount of transportation payment or reimbursement will be equal to the most economical and reasonable common carrier for the distances involved. Daily subsistence will be provided at a rate of $14 per day during travel to a maximum of $59.00 per day with receipts.

 

3/4s Guarantee: The worker is guaranteed employment for a total number of work hours equal to at least three-fourths of the workdays of each 6-week period. 

 

Tools, equipment & supplies: All work will be done with employer provided tools, supplies and equipment without charge or deposit.

 

Miscellaneous: Will use a single workweek as its standard for computing wages due. Wage paid every two weeks. All deductions required by law will be done by the employer.  Will reimburse the H-2B worker in the first workweek for all visa, visa processing, border crossing, and other related fees, including those mandated by the government, incurred by the H-2B worker (not including passport). Any worker who voluntarily abandons employment is not entitled to payment for outbound transportation or the full 3/4s Guarantee described.
